Course Overview
In this course, students create rich Internet applications with Adobe® Flash® CS3 using ActionScript™. They create Flash-based movies that contain graphics, text, and animations. They manage forms, perform calculations, and tailor the interface.

At Course Completion
Upon successful completion of this course, students will be able to:
- use basic ActionScript code.
- manipulate components with ActionScript.
- work with movie clips.
- add data to your application using built-in classes.
- reuse code with functions.
- connect to external data.
- build a navigation system.
- manage user data with forms.
Course Outline
Lesson 1: Using Actionscript
- Using ActionScript
- Add Components from the Actions Panel
- Trace a String
- Populate a Text Area with ActionScript
- Store Data in Variables
Lesson 2: Manipulating Components with ActionScript
- Create an Event Handler
- Create a Form with Interactive Components
- Use Conditional Logic in ActionScript
Lesson 3: Working with Movie Clips
- Create a Movie Clip
- Check for Movie Clip Collisions
- Attach a Movie Clip from the Library Panel
Lesson 4: Adding Data Using Built-in Classes
- Create a Dynamic Text Field
- Read Data from a Text File
Lesson 5: Reusing Code with Functions
- Streamline Code Using Built-in Functions
- Create User-Defined Functions
- Reference an External ActionScript File
Lesson 6: Connecting to External Data
- Examine Dynamic Content in Flash
- Add Data to an XML File
- Load Data from an External Data Source
- Create Dependent Components
Lesson 7: Building a Navigation System
- Display SWFs from Menu Options
- Add a Submenu
Lesson 8: Managing User Data using Forms
- Gather User Data with a Form
- Create a Submit Button
- Submit User Data
